On ath79 build for DIR-825B1 tx-power on 2.4 GHz doesn't set to maximum 19 dBm.
It is allowed in degdb and is listed in iw list.
But setting it to 19dBm results in 18dBm.

I seem to have the same issue on a BT Home Hub 5 Type A.
The transmit power for radio 1 (AR9287 - 2.4GHz) defaults to 18dBm and although it offers 19dBm and 20dBm they won't apply. It'll only use 20dBm if I change the country code to the US, despite 100mW being the maximum across Europe.
The maximum configurable txpower is based on the maximum allowed value minus the antenna gain. I assume the antenna gain for your device is 2 dB, so you can't set anything above 18dB for the txpower?
